Gull Posted June 4, 2008 #1 Share Posted June 4, 2008 I'm having a problem with the new TA I'm using that came very highly recommended from a close friend. The TA is a discount internet group and their prices were very low. However, I've been trying to get information from them on cost to upgrade my cabin. I've e-mailed they do not respond. I call and speak to various TA's at the agency who promise to call back and do not. The cabins we have are paid in full. I'm at a loss as to what to do. Any suggestions? 98Charlie Posted June 4, 2008 #2 Share Posted June 4, 2008 Call the main # for the agency and ask to speak to a supervisor. If you get no response continuing to call and ask to speak to the supervisor's superior. There is no excuse for a TA (online or local) to not call back and answer pax questions whether those pax are paid in full or not. Dianne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

Gull Posted June 5, 2008 Author #7 Share Posted June 5, 2008 Thanks everyone for your replies. Ironically, I did receive a response from the TA almost immediately after I posted. NCL is offering to allow me to upgrade but for $100 more than what they show online as the rate. I've decided that it just isn't worth it. We'll stay in our current cabin and live without the balcany. I am going to call NCL to confirm they received the payment as someone suggested. Especially since we've paid for two rooms.
